/**
* Implementation of the ConnectionSource interface that supports basic pooled connections. New connections are created
* on demand only if there are no dormant connections otherwise released connections will be reused. This class is
* reentrant and can handle requests from multiple threads.
*
*
* WARNING: As of 10/2010 this is one of the newer parts of ORMLite meaning it may still have bugs. Additional
* review of the code and any feedback would be appreciated.
*
*
*
* NOTE: If you are using the Spring type wiring in Java, {@link #initialize} should be called after all of the
* set methods. In Spring XML, init-method="initialize" should be used.
*
*
* @author graywatson
*/

@Override
public DatabaseConnection getReadWriteConnection() throws SQLException {
checkInitializedSqlException();
DatabaseConnection conn = getSavedConnection();
if (conn != null) {
return conn;
}
synchronized (lock) {
long now = System.currentTimeMillis();
while (connFreeList.size() > 0) {
// take the first one off of the list
ConnectionMetaData connMetaData = connFreeList.remove(0);
// is it already expired
if (connMetaData.isExpired(now)) {
// close expired connection
closeConnection(connMetaData.connection);
} else {
logger.debug("reusing connection {}", connMetaData);
return connMetaData.connection;
}
}
// if none in the free list then make a new one
DatabaseConnection connection = makeConnection(logger);
openCount++;
// add it to our connection map
connectionMap.put(connection, new ConnectionMetaData(connection));
int maxInUse = connectionMap.size();
if (maxInUse > maxEverUsed) {
maxEverUsed = maxInUse;
}
return connection;
}
}
@Override
public void releaseConnection(DatabaseConnection connection) throws SQLException {
checkInitializedSqlException();
if (isSavedConnection(connection)) {
// ignore the release when we are in a transaction
return;
}
synchronized (lock) {
if (connection.isClosed()) {
// it's already closed so just drop it
ConnectionMetaData meta = connectionMap.remove(connection);
if (meta == null) {
logger.debug("dropping already closed unknown connection {}", connection);
} else {
logger.debug("dropping already closed connection {}", meta);
}
return;
}
if (connFreeList == null) {
// if we've already closed the pool then just close the connection
closeConnection(connection);
return;
}
ConnectionMetaData meta = connectionMap.get(connection);
if (meta == null) {
logger.error("should have found connection {} in the map", connection);
closeConnection(connection);
} else {
connFreeList.add(meta);
logger.debug("cache released connection {}", meta);
if (connFreeList.size() > maxConnectionsFree) {
// close the first connection in the queue
meta = connFreeList.remove(0);
logger.debug("cache too full, closing connection {}", meta);
closeConnection(meta.connection);
}
}
}
}
